I just got accepted into a couple of CPA networks and looking around I find that there are a lot of new terms used that I've not heard of before. One of them is a tracking pixel.

I did some search on what it is, but all I found out was that it's used for tracking - something which I figured out on my own. But what I really want to know is what is the right way to use them?

Some people mentioned that you should put it in your thank you page to track conversions, but in the case of CPA, you have no control over any pages after someone clicks on your link. Or am I missing something here?

    A tracking pixel is a piece of code that can be added to the first page after the conversion to let a tracking software receive information about each conversion.

    For example, one of the most popular tracking softwares for people working with PPC is Prosper202. If you add Prosper's tracking pixel to an offer it will be able to tell you what keywords are bringing more conversions, what landing pages are performing better, etc...

      Originally Posted by NK View Post

      So you're not supposed to put it on the page where the offer shows?
      No... if you did that then the pixel would fire every time someone looked at the offer page whether they completed it or not and then your stats would be showing conversions when no conversion actually took place.


      But how do I add the tracking pixel to a page after the conversion?
      Call your affiliate manager at the cpa network and tell him/her you have a tracking pixel you would like to place for a specific offer. They will either tell you to email it over and they will place it for you or if the network has the ability for you to add the pixels yourself he/she can explain that to you. Either way, it's really simple.
